Security Policy

Reporting a vulnerability

Do not open a public GitHub issue for a security problem.

If you find a vulnerability in Mullgate:

  • email contact@micr.dev
  • include the affected version, operating system, and a minimal reproduction
  • include whether the issue exposes credentials, account numbers, or proxy traffic

You will get an acknowledgement as soon as practical. Please avoid publicly disclosing the issue until a fix or mitigation is ready.

Scope

Security reports are especially useful for:

  • credential leakage
  • auth bypass
  • unsafe proxy exposure defaults
  • command injection
  • dependency or packaging supply-chain issues

Secrets handling

Never include real Mullvad account numbers, proxy passwords, API tokens, private keys, or full runtime config files in public issues or pull requests.
